The Asia Pacific toys and hobby products market is expected to be valued at USD 100 billion in 2025, rising to USD 150 billion by 2031. This expansion is being driven by rising disposable income, changing lifestyles, and the region's growing need for educational, environmentally responsible, and inventive toys.
The Asia Pacific toys and hobby goods market is projected to grow significantly between 2025 and 2031, owing to increased disposable incomes and changing lifestyle trends. Increased demand for educational, STEM, and eco-friendly toys, combined with growing interest in online shopping, is expected to drive market growth throughout the forecast period.
According to 6Wresearch, Asia Pacific Toys and Hobby Goods Market size is expected to grow at a significant CAGR of 7% during 2025-2031. The Asia Pacific toys and hobby goods market is propelled by factors such as a growing population of younger demographics, rising disposable incomes, and an increasing affinity for educational and interactive toys. Technological advancements have introduced innovative products that cater to evolving consumer preferences, while the growing popularity of hobbies among adults, such as collectible figures and model kits, has diversified market demand, leading to the Asia Pacific Toys and Hobby Goods Market growth. However, the market faces challenges including the high cost of producing specialty items, competition from unbranded or low-cost products, and regulatory requirements surrounding safety standards. Balancing innovation with affordability and compliance will be essential for manufacturers to thrive in this competitive landscape.
The Asia Pacific toys and hobby goods industry is being impacted by a number of significant trends. One is the rising demand for STEM and educational toys as parents place a higher value on their kids' cognitive development in math, science, technology, and engineering. As shoppers look for toys that are sustainable and ecologically sensitive, eco-friendly products are becoming more and more popular. Furthermore, licensed products is becoming more and more popular; toys featuring characters from video games, TV series, and films are in high demand. In the upcoming years, it is anticipated that these trends will propel market expansion.

Mattel Inc., LEGO Group, Hasbro Inc., Bandai Namco Holdings Inc., and Tomy Company Ltd. are a few of the major companies in the toys and hobby goods industry in Asia Pacific. By launching new product lines that address changing consumer desires, like educational, STEM-based toys and environmentally responsible goods, these businesses are aggressively promoting innovation. In order to meet the rising demand for branded items, they also concentrate on diversifying their product offerings and establishing strategic partnerships to increase their visibility.
The Asia Pacific region's governments have taken a number of steps to encourage a toy sector that is both safe and healthy. To safeguard consumers and maintain product quality, the General Administration of Quality Supervision, Inspection, and Quarantine (AQSIQ) in China maintains strict safety regulations for toys. Similar to this, the Indian government has started initiatives like "Make in India" and "Vocal for Local" to promote the manufacture and use of handcrafted and traditional toys, with a focus on sustainability and cultural heritage preservation. These programs seek to promote regional local workmanship, safety, and quality while fostering the expansion of the toy sector.

According to Ravi Bhandari, Research Head, 6Wresearch, the sports toys segment dominates the Asia Pacific toys and hobby goods industry, owing to children's increased interest in physical activity. Sports-related toys are becoming more and more popular in the area as parents place a greater emphasis on outside play and fitness.
China is currently prevailing the Asia Pacific toys and hobby goods industry, accounting for more than 35% of the total market share. The nation's dominant position in the industry is a result of its sizable customer base, expanding middle class, and growing desire for licensed and instructional toys.
